It's a good list, and hard to argue about anyone there. A few omissions that come to mind:
  • Katelynn Flaherty, Jr., Michigan (19.9 points per game)
  • Monique Billings, Jr., UCLA (17.8 ppg, 10.5 rebounds pg)
  • Brooke Schulte, Sr., DePaul (16.4 ppg, 52.2% FG)
  • Mehryn Kraker, Sr., Green Bay (19.1 ppg, 3.6 assists pg)
Interesting that Notre Dame got three players on the list (the only team other than UConn to do so, in fact) while Baylor only got one (A. Jones) and Texas none. I'll try to put a positive spin and take that as a tribute to how well balanced the latter two teams are.
